FP&A Analyst

At Lanes Group, we're more than just the UK's largest independent wastewater solutions provider. We're a fast-paced, growing organisation with a commitment to innovation, operational excellence, and investing in our people.

We're looking for an ambitious FP&A Analyst to join our Financial Planning & Analysis team at our Leeds Head Office. This is an exciting opportunity for a commercially minded finance professional who enjoys turning data into insight and helping stakeholders make informed business decisions.

What You'll Be Doing

• Support annual budgeting, quarterly forecasting and long-range planning processes.

• Develop and maintain robust financial models to support business decision-making.

• Analyse monthly financial performance against budget and forecast, identifying key trends and variances.

• Produce insightful management reporting packs and financial commentary.

• Analyse revenue, costs, margins and KPI performance.

• Work collaboratively with Financial Control and Commercial Finance teams to deliver meaningful business insights.

• Investigate performance drivers and identify opportunities for improvement.

• Conduct detailed analysis around customer profitability, pricing strategies, product mix and operational efficiency.

• Support business planning through scenario modelling, sensitivity analysis and ROI assessments.

• Champion reporting automation and data transformation initiatives using Power BI and FP&A systems.

• Provide data-driven recommendations to support strategic commercial decisions and business growth.

You'll ideally have:

• A deg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ics or a related discipline.

• At least 2 years' experience within FP&A, Commercial Finance or Business Analysis.

• Advanced Excel and financial modelling skills.

• Experience using ERP systems such as SAP or Oracle.

• Experience with BI and reporting tools such as Power BI or Tableau.

• A strong understanding of forecasting, margin analysis and commercial performance metrics.

• Excellent communication and presentation skills.

• The ability to build strong relationships and work collaboratively across multiple business functions.

• Strong attention to detail and the ability to manage competing priorities in a fast-paced environment.
